How to Make Tahiti Blondies

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Lightly grease a 9x13 inch baking pan with cooking spray.
  3. In a medium bowl, whisk together 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our, 1 teaspoon baking powder, and ½ teaspoon salt. Set aside.
  4. In a large bowl, cream together 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ened, and ¾ cup packed light brown sugar until light and fluffy.
  5. Beat in 2 large eggs one at a time, then stir in 1 teaspoon vanilla extract.
  6.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Do not overmix.
  7. Stir in 1 cup sweetened shredded coconut, 1 cup chopped cashews (or macadamia nuts), 1 cup drained crushed pineapple, and 1 cup white chocolate chips.
  8. Pour batter into the prepared pan and spread evenly.
  9.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with just a few moist crumbs attached. Do not overbake!
  10. Let cool completely in the pan before cutting into squares.
  11. Use a round cookie cutter (optional) to create individual blondies, replicating the Throwdown challenge look!
